Mitashi unveils 50-inch Android-based Smart HDTV for Rs. 51,990

Mitashi 1

Mumbai – Mitashi has launched its latest 50-inch android based smart HDTV in India. The television is priced at Rs. 51,990. The full-HD Smart LED television is dubbed MiDE050v01.

Other features include Android 4.4 based user interface enabling smooth functioning, 1920×1080 pixel FHD screen, USB plug-and-play functionality supporting 27 video formats, Wi-Fi connectivity, Ethernet and more.

Other additional features include single PC input, a 512MB RAM, dual-core processor, dynamic contrast ratio of 500, 000:1 and inputs of three HDMI. The smart LED TV comes with a three-year warranty.

Toys and Games from Mitashi

Mitashi was started in Mumbai in 1998 and since then has introduced many educational products for the kids along with toys and video games. Over the years, the company has also introduced a range of televisions and the first Android-based device for gaming in India-GameIn Thunder Bolt.

The educational game from Mitashi, Skykidz have become very much popular, and it is a completely new approach to learning something new.

You can use this game as a gateway to make your children learn math, drawing, puzzle, music and even relate a story. The apps are specially created to make children understand the topic well.

The company has also launched some of the coolest tablets and mobiles in the market. From basic mobiles to Android-based smartphone versions, Mitashi offer you multiple choices in mobiles and tablets.

Android Jelly Beans, dual SIM, dual-core processor are a part of Mitashi smartphone and tablet features. Apart from these products, Mitashi has also been the manufacturer and marketer of many other electronic goods including high-quality speakers with subwoofers, FM radios and digital FM radios and music systems.

Mitashi offers a wide range of choice in electronic goods including home theaters, headphones, portable devices and air conditioners. Despite all the range, the company has not been able to dominate the market with its product range and requires better marketing tactics for meeting its goals.
